AN inquest heard how SAS soldiers trying to rescue two comrades thought trapped in a burning helicopter had to be ordered away from their efforts just seconds before the aircraft exploded.

In evidence at Hereford Town Hall this morning (Monday) Soldier K, second in command of the mission in Iraq in November 2007, described the harrowing sequence of the rescue attempt - using whatever the soldiers had to hand - in increasing heat and flame with ammunition and flares going off all around.

The inquest heard how the Puma helicopter crashed while trying to land an SAS team tasked to a special night-time operation.

"I had to order the guys away, there was just enough time to get back," said Soldier K.

Sgt John Battersby and Tpr Lee Fitzsimmons died in the crash.
